The April 21 issue of Toy World is out now

Published on: 6th April 2021

The latest issue of Toy World Magazine – the April 21 edition – is out now and available to read online.

This month’s edition includes an exclusive interview with new ‘entertainment commerce’ platform, OOOOO, and we hear about how this unique proposition plans to shake up the toy market. We also interviewed Exploding Kittens about the company’s plans for 2021, talked to HTI about its new Fleetwood-based bubbles facility, and heard about Geomag’s latest sustainability initiatives, Flair’s launch range for Blues Clues, and how Zuru’s 5 Surprise Mini Brands range is developing.

There are in depth category features on some of the market’s most successful and competitive categories; namely Pre-school, Games & Puzzles and Collectibles, as well as regulars Talking Shop, Letter from America, NPD Insight, Allegedly and the latest BTHA Briefing.

In Touching Base, leading suppliers tell us how they have found preview season and how they are supporting retailers.

As well as all the latest industry, people, marketing and licensing news, the issue also features expert columns from Generation Media on using live data for marketing and KidsKnowBest on recent research into kids’ friendships, as well as the popular Fresh section featuring the very latest product introductions to the market.
